When the idol is immersed

The idol is kept for one and a half, three, five, seven days or until Anant Chaturdashi — it is a family custom rather than a rule, and community mandapams usually keep it longest.

Use the designated immersion point

Many gram panchayats and municipalities set aside a pond or a marked stretch of tank for immersion. Ask at the panchayat office — it changes year to year, and a drinking-water tank or a farm pond is not an alternative.

Unpainted clay dissolves, plaster of Paris does not

A clay idol breaks down in water within hours. Plaster of Paris does not, and the paints carry heavy metals, so idols accumulate in tanks and rivers after immersion. Pollution control boards in most states now ask for clay for exactly this reason.

Someone should be watching the water, not the idol

Immersion points get crowded and the bank is slippery after the monsoon. Children go into the water at these gatherings every year. Keep one person watching the water rather than the procession.

Take the accessories home

Thermocol, plastic sheeting, cloth and metal ornaments do not belong in the tank even when the idol itself is clay. Most organised immersion points now have a collection bin at the bank for them.

Bamnai at a glance

Bamnai is a village of 123 people in 28 households (Census 2011) in Handiya tehsil, Harda district, Madhya Pradesh, the 90th-largest of 110 villages in Handiya tehsil. Literacy is 46%, 8 points below the tehsil average of 54% and the sex ratio is 1,085 women per 1,000 men. It lies 6 km from the Harda district centre, 16 km from Charkhera railway station (straight-line distances). The pincode is 461331, served by Harda post office; the LGD village code is 486906. The nearest hospital or health centre is Govt Hospital, Nemawar, 10 km away. The sarpanch is Suman Bai, and the village votes in Khategaon assembly constituency, represented by MLA Aashish Govind Sharma. The population is estimated at 145 in 2026, up 18% since the 2011 Census.
